阿里云编译怎么用?5个实用技巧快速上手

想快速掌握阿里云编译,核心并不在于记住多少术语,而在于先理解它在研发流程中的位置:代码提交、自动构建、测试校验、产物输出,再到后续交付。很多团队第一次接触阿里云编译时,往往只把它当成“在线打包工具”,其实它更像是连接代码仓库、构建环境与交付流程的关键枢纽。

阿里云编译怎么用?5个实用技巧快速上手

本文围绕“阿里云编译怎么用?5个实用技巧快速上手”这一主题,从基础概念、配置步骤、常见技巧、效率优化和问题排查几个方面展开,帮助你用更短时间把阿里云编译真正用起来。无论你是个人开发者,还是中小团队的研发负责人,只要掌握方法,就能让构建流程更稳定、更可控。

一、阿里云编译是什么?先搞清楚核心用途

阿里云编译本质上是一套面向持续集成场景的自动化构建能力,能够在代码发生变更后,按照预设规则完成拉取代码、安装依赖、执行脚本、编译打包和输出制品等动作。它的价值不只是“省事”,更重要的是降低手工操作带来的环境差异和人为失误。

对于前端、Java、Go、Node.js、Python等常见项目来说,阿里云编译都可以作为统一入口,帮助团队把原本分散在本地电脑上的命令执行过程迁移到云端。这样做的好处很明显:构建记录可追踪、任务执行可复现、多人协作时标准也更统一。

阿里云编译适合哪些使用场景

如果你的项目经常需要手动打包、发布前需要反复确认环境,或者团队成员使用的开发环境差异较大,那么阿里云编译会非常适合。它尤其适用于有版本管理、多人协作、频繁迭代的业务项目。

对于希望建立规范研发流程的团队而言,阿里云编译还能和代码仓库、流水线、制品管理配合使用,逐步形成完整的DevOps实践。即使刚开始只是做自动打包,也能为后续持续交付打下基础。

二、第一次使用阿里云编译:从创建任务到成功构建

初次上手阿里云编译,建议不要一开始就配置复杂流程,而是先完成一个最小可运行版本。也就是说,只做一件事:把仓库中的代码拉下来,执行最基础的构建命令,然后确认产物能够正常输出。

一般来说,第一次使用可以按“选择代码源、配置构建环境、填写构建命令、设置触发方式、执行构建”这个顺序推进。步骤看似不少,但只要每一步都围绕项目真实需求配置,其实上手并不困难。

基础配置的关键步骤

  1. 先连接代码仓库,确保阿里云编译可以读取目标分支的代码内容。
  2. 选择适合项目的运行环境,例如Node.js版本、JDK版本或基础镜像。
  3. 填写构建命令,比如安装依赖、运行测试、执行打包脚本等。
  4. 设置构建产物输出路径,便于后续下载、部署或归档。
  5. 根据需要选择手动触发、定时触发或代码提交后自动触发。

这里最容易出问题的往往不是平台本身,而是命令和环境不匹配。比如本地使用的是Node 18,但云端仍配置为Node 14;又或者本地依赖缓存存在,而云端是全新环境,导致某些隐性依赖缺失,这些都需要在第一次配置时重点检查。

如何判断首次构建是否成功

很多人以为看到“构建完成”就算成功,其实还要再往前看一步:产物是否可用、日志是否完整、关键步骤有没有隐藏报错。真正合格的首次阿里云编译任务,应该具备可重复执行、结果一致、日志清晰这三个特点。

如果第一次构建已经能稳定输出制品,说明基础链路已经打通。接下来要做的,就不是盲目增加步骤,而是逐步加入测试、参数化和通知机制,让构建任务更贴近实际业务流程。

三、5个阿里云编译实用技巧,帮助你快速上手

想把阿里云编译真正用顺手,关键在于掌握一些高频、实用、能立刻提升效率的技巧。下面这5个方法并不复杂,但在日常构建中非常常用,尤其适合刚开始搭建自动化流程的团队。

技巧1:先做最小化脚本,再逐步扩展

很多用户第一次配置阿里云编译时,喜欢把安装、测试、打包、压缩、上传全部塞进一次任务里,结果一旦报错就很难定位。更好的方式是先保证“代码拉取+基础构建”跑通,再按模块逐步增加步骤。

这样做的好处是可控性更强,日志也更容易分析。每新增一段命令,就验证一次结果,既能快速发现问题,也能避免后期任务变得过于臃肿。

技巧2:善用环境变量管理敏感信息

在阿里云编译中,很多项目会用到Token、账号、访问密钥或部署参数,这些内容不适合直接写进脚本。推荐统一放入环境变量中管理,既能提升安全性,也方便在不同环境之间切换。

比如测试环境和生产环境往往有不同的配置项,如果把它们拆分成变量,就能通过不同任务或不同参数实现快速复用。这样不仅减少重复劳动,也能降低误发布风险。

技巧3:把依赖安装与缓存策略结合起来

阿里云编译的耗时,很多时候都花在依赖下载阶段,尤其是前端项目和多模块项目。若平台支持缓存机制,建议优先缓存依赖目录或包管理器相关文件,这样能显著缩短重复构建时间。

当然,缓存不是越多越好。缓存策略要结合依赖更新频率和构建稳定性来设定,避免因为缓存过旧导致构建结果异常。稳定的缓存方案,往往是在速度和准确性之间找到平衡。

技巧4:让分支触发规则更清晰

实际使用阿里云编译时,不同分支通常承担不同职责,例如开发分支用于联调,主分支用于正式发布。此时如果所有分支都共用一套触发规则,很容易造成无效构建增加,甚至影响资源利用率。

建议根据分支类型设置不同的触发策略,例如开发分支自动构建但不发布,主分支构建后进入发布审批流程。这样既保证效率,也能让流程更符合团队协作逻辑。

技巧5:学会通过日志快速定位问题

判断阿里云编译是否“好用”,很大程度上取决于你能否高效读懂日志。与其遇到失败就反复重试,不如先从日志里确认失败发生在哪个阶段:拉取代码失败、依赖安装失败、测试失败,还是打包命令本身出错。

一旦养成按阶段阅读日志的习惯,排障效率会明显提升。尤其是在多人协作场景下,清晰的构建日志不仅能帮助当前问题处理,也能为后续流程优化提供依据。

四、阿里云编译怎么提高效率?从环境、流程到协作优化

当基础任务已经稳定运行后,下一步就应该考虑如何让阿里云编译跑得更快、用得更稳。很多团队构建慢、失败率高,并不是因为工具能力不足,而是环境选择、脚本设计和任务拆分方式不合理。

效率优化的重点,不是盲目追求“最快”,而是让每一次构建都更有价值。换句话说,要减少无意义执行、缩短等待时间,并提高构建结果的可靠性。

优化构建环境选择

首先要确保构建环境与生产或测试环境尽可能一致,至少在运行时版本上保持匹配。比如Java项目要注意JDK版本,Node项目要统一Node与包管理器版本,否则同一份代码在不同环境下结果可能不一致。

其次,尽量为不同类型项目准备相对明确的构建模板。模板化后,新项目接入阿里云编译时不必从零开始搭建,也能减少因复制脚本不完整带来的问题。

优化任务拆分与执行顺序

如果一个任务里同时包含静态检查、单元测试、构建打包、镜像制作和上传部署,那么任何一步失败都会导致整体重来。更合理的方式是按阶段拆分任务,把容易变动的环节与稳定环节分开。

例如先执行代码质量检查,再执行单元测试,最后再进入正式打包。这样不仅能更早发现问题,也能避免把资源浪费在本该提前终止的构建上。

优化团队协作体验

对于多人开发场景,统一脚本入口非常重要。建议把本地执行命令和阿里云编译中的命令保持一致,例如都通过npm scripts、Makefile或统一Shell脚本执行,这样本地和云端行为更容易对齐。

同时,构建通知也要纳入协作设计中。任务成功或失败后,如果能及时通知到相关人员,团队处理问题的响应速度会明显提升,避免构建失败后长时间无人关注。

五、阿里云编译常见问题与排查思路

即便已经掌握了配置方法,使用阿里云编译时仍可能遇到各种问题。与其把每次失败都当成偶发事件,不如总结出一套固定的排查思路,这样面对不同报错时就不会手忙脚乱。

大多数构建问题,其实都集中在环境不一致、权限不足、脚本错误、依赖冲突和产物路径配置异常这几类。只要按顺序排查,通常都能较快定位原因。

常见问题清单

  • 代码仓库连接正常,但拉取代码时提示权限不足。
  • 构建环境版本与项目要求不匹配,导致依赖安装失败。
  • 脚本在本地能跑,在阿里云编译中却报命令不存在。
  • 测试步骤耗时过长,最终超时退出。
  • 构建成功但找不到制品,通常是输出路径配置错误。

高效排查的顺序建议

  1. 先看失败发生在哪个阶段,而不是先修改脚本。
  2. 再核对环境版本、依赖管理工具和执行目录是否正确。
  3. 检查变量、密钥、访问权限等外部条件是否完整。
  4. 确认产物目录、缓存策略和触发规则是否影响结果。
  5. 最后再考虑是否需要调整脚本结构或拆分任务。

很多用户在使用阿里云编译时,最常见的误区就是“一失败就重跑”。如果根因是权限或命令错误,重复执行只会浪费时间。建立结构化排查流程,才是长期稳定使用的关键。

六、总结:掌握阿里云编译,关键在于先跑通再优化

回到最初的问题,阿里云编译怎么用?最实用的答案其实很明确:先从最小构建任务开始,完成代码拉取、命令执行和产物输出,再通过环境变量、缓存、分支规则和日志分析一步步提升效率。这样上手快,也更不容易在复杂配置中迷失方向。

如果你希望真正用好阿里云编译,不要只停留在“能打包”这一层,而要把它看作研发流程标准化的重要工具。只要基础配置正确、脚本结构清晰、排查思路明确,阿里云编译就能帮助你更稳定地支撑项目构建与持续集成,这也是团队快速上手并长期受益的核心所在。

内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。

本文由星速云发布。发布者:星速云小编。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/155912.html

(0)
上一篇 1小时前
下一篇 1小时前
联系我们
关注微信
关注微信
分享本页
返回顶部